Abstract
As the lack of dissolved oxygen made fishes dead, a monitor system is designed to improve the aquiculture environment factors. The system, based on SCM, wireless RF and GSM technology, can measure environment parameters on-line, such as temperature, dissolved oxygen (DO) content and so on. And according to the environmental conditions, it can control the oxygen-increasing machine and remote control of data by computer or receive the report of information by mobile phone. The test result shows the project is effective to monitor the water quality and is to be applied extensively.
